The most famous 'guesstimation' based on the Drake equation says there should be something around 10 civilizations in our galaxy. But there are other factors that influence here, like the tendency a civilization has to destroy itself before it reaches the space exploration era (and also the tendency it has to destroy other civilizations) [2]
Also, the fact that we have found none yet comes the famous Fermi paradox [2]. Alternative explanations for the seemly inexistence of extraterrestrian civilizations exist, such as impossibility of communication between long distanced civilizations.
